Ant control, ant extermination, and carpenter ant removal
Ants are the most persistent nuisance for homeowners in Austin. One small trail often leads to a much larger colony hidden within walls or under the foundation. While sugar ants are frustrating, carpenter ants pose a physical threat to the structure of your home by excavating wood to build nests. In our area, sudden rain or extreme heat can drive these pests indoors in search of food and water. Effective ant control requires identifying the specific species to choose the right treatment method.
Common signs and problems we handle:
- Trails of ants moving along baseboards or countertops
- Large black ants seeing near window sills or door frames
- Piles of wood shavings looking like sawdust
- Faint rustling sounds inside walls
- Flying ants swarming inside the home
- Painful bites from fire ants in the yard
- Ants returning immediately after using store sprays
How we approach treatment:
We start by tracking the trail back to the source. Our technicians use integrated pest management to locate the colony and the queen. We utilize targeted ant extermination methods that may include baiting systems to let the ants carry the product back to the nest, ensuring total elimination of pests. We also advise on exclusion techniques for pests, such as sealing entry points around utility pipes, to prevent future invasions.
Bed bug eradication and treatment planning
Bed bugs are a major source of anxiety and sleep loss. These hitchhikers can enter your home on luggage, used furniture, or clothing, and they spread quickly through bedrooms and living areas. In a busy city like Austin, bed bug eradication is a frequent need for both apartments and single family homes. These pests are excellent at hiding in mattress seams, behind headboards, and even behind electrical outlets, making professional intervention necessary for complete removal.
Common signs and problems we handle:
- Waking up with itchy red welts in rows
- Tiny dark spots on bed sheets or pillowcases
- Discarded skins or shells around the bed frame
- Musty or sweet odors in the room
- Live bugs hiding in furniture joints
- Anxiety about sleeping in your own bed
How we approach treatment:
Our process begins with a meticulous pest inspection to determine the extent of the infestation. Bed bug eradication requires precision. We treat all potential hiding spots, not just the bed. Our strategy involves a combination of treatment applications and monitoring. We also provide guidance on how to launder items and prepare your home to ensure the treatment is effective. We focus on breaking the life cycle of the bug to stop new eggs from hatching.
Roach extermination and roach infestation control
Cockroaches are resilient and can pose sanitation issues for households. In the Austin area, we commonly see German cockroaches indoors and larger American cockroaches, often called water bugs, entering from outside. Roaches love the humidity and often congregate in kitchens and bathrooms. A roach infestation control plan is vital because these pests reproduce rapidly and can contaminate food sources and surfaces.
Common signs and problems we handle:
- Seeing live roaches when turning on kitchen lights
- Droppings that look like coffee grounds in drawers
- Egg casings found in pantries or behind appliances
- Unpleasant oily or musty smells
- Roaches appearing in sinks or bathtubs
- Smears on surfaces where pests travel
How we approach treatment:
We utilize flush out agents and baiting systems to target roaches where they hide. Identifying the species is step one, as German roaches require different tactics than American roaches. We focus on hygienic pest removal by targeting nesting sites behind cabinets and appliances. We also provide recommendations on sanitation and moisture control, such as fixing leaky pipes, which helps with long term pest control.
Spider removal and indoor pest control support
While many spiders are harmless, finding them inside your home is unsettling. Austin is home to species like the black widow and brown recluse, which require careful handling due to their bites. Most spiders enter homes looking for prey or shelter from the weather. Spider removal is often about controlling the other insects that spiders eat. Reducing the general pest population usually leads to a natural decrease in spider activity.
Common signs and problems we handle:
- Webs in corners near ceilings or light fixtures
- Spiders hiding in shoes or closets
- Egg sacs found in garages or sheds
- Frequent sightings of wolf spiders on floors
- Cobwebs accumulating in basements or crawlspaces
- Concerns about venomous spiders
How we approach treatment:
Our team performs a careful sweep of the property to de-web the exterior and interior. We apply barrier treatments around windows, doors, and foundations to discourage entry. For indoor pest control, we focus on cracks and crevices where spiders retreat. By addressing the food source through general insect control, we make your home a less attractive hunting ground for arachnids.
Flea treatment and tick removal for safer living spaces
Fleas and ticks are not just a problem for pets; they invade living spaces and yards, causing discomfort for the whole family. The mild winters in Texas mean flea and tick seasons can last almost all year. Flea treatment is essential once they enter the home, as eggs can remain dormant in carpets for weeks. Ticks pose health risks and are often found in tall grass or brought in by wildlife passing through your property.
Common signs and problems we handle:
- Pets scratching or biting their fur constantly
- Tiny black jumping pests on carpets or furniture
- Flea bites on ankles and legs
- Ticks found on clothing after being in the yard
- Larvae found in pet bedding
- Recurring infestations despite washing bedding
How we approach treatment:
Successful control requires treating both the pet (by your vet) and the environment. We provide interior treatments that target adult fleas and growth regulators to stop larvae from developing. For the exterior, we focus on tick removal by treating shaded areas and tall grass where these pests wait for a host. We work with you to identify wildlife paths that might be introducing these pests to your yard.
Termite inspection, termite treatment, and long term protection
Termites are a serious threat to property value in our region. Subterranean termites work silently, eating wood from the inside out, often going unnoticed until significant damage is done. Given the prevalence of wood framing in Austin homes, professional termite inspection is critical for early detection. Termite treatment is an investment in the longevity of your home, protecting it from the structural instability these insects cause.
Common signs and problems we handle:
- Mud tubes climbing up the foundation exterior
- Hollow sounding wood when tapped
- Discarded wings near windows or doors
- Bubbling paint that looks like water damage
- Frass or wood pellets near walls
- Sagging floors or ceilings in severe cases
How we approach treatment:
We use advanced detection methods to assess termite activity. Our termite treatment options may include liquid barriers applied to the soil around your foundation or bait stations that monitor and eliminate colonies. We focus on creating a continuous protective zone. We also provide guidance on reducing wood to ground contact and managing moisture, which are key factors in termite prevention.
Rodent removal, mice extermination, and rat control
Mice and rats seek shelter in homes when the temperatures shift or when construction disturbs their natural habitats. Rodents are capable of squeezing through incredibly small openings to access attics, crawlspaces, and pantries. Beyond the noise and mess, rodent removal is a health priority because they carry pathogens and can chew through electrical wiring. Proper rat control involves more than just traps; it requires understanding how they move and where they nest.
Common signs and problems we handle:
- Scratching or scampering noises in ceilings at night
- Droppings found in cupboards or along walls
- Chew marks on food packaging or plastic bins
- Nesting material like shredded paper in the attic
- Grease marks or rub marks along baseboards
- Ammonia like smells in hidden areas
How we approach treatment:
Our rodent barrier installation strategies are key. We inspect the roofline, vents, and foundation for entry points. We use humane and effective trapping methods for mice extermination to clear the current population. Once the interior is secure, we focus on exclusion techniques for pests, sealing holes with durable materials that rodents cannot chew through to prevent them from returning.

Professional Pest Control vs DIY Approaches
Many homeowners try to handle pest problems themselves before calling a professional. While buying a can of spray at the hardware store seems easy, DIY remedies often fail to address the root of the problem. Over the counter products can scatter pests, causing them to spread to new areas of the house rather than eliminating them. For example, using a fogger for bed bugs often drives them deeper into the walls, making the infestation much harder to treat later.
Misidentifying pests is another common issue. Mistaking a carpenter ant for a sugar ant means using the wrong bait, which allows the colony to keep growing and damaging your wood. Professional pest control ensures correct identification. We know the difference in nesting habits and food preferences for various species, allowing us to select the most effective solution.
Safety is a primary concern. Storing and applying chemicals requires knowledge to protect your family and pets. Our technicians are trained in the safe use of products and application methods that minimize exposure. Furthermore, professional extermination services offer exclusion techniques for pests that DIY kits lack. We have the tools and materials to seal entry points and implement pest proofing strategies, providing a level of protection that goes far beyond a temporary fix.

What are the tips for preventing rodent infestations in winter?
As temperatures drop, rodents seek warmth. Seal gaps around doors and windows, cover vents with mesh, and keep food stored in airtight containers. Reducing clutter in garages and attics also removes potential nesting sites for mice and rats.
